本文轉自【中國日報網】;
11月29日,由騰訊雲與微信聯合主辦的第二屆“小程式·雲開發”技術峰會在北京召開。官方公佈的資料顯示,雲開發的註冊使用者數達到56萬,較去年同期增長1.5倍,服務超過100萬開發者,日呼叫次數超過7億。這標誌著,雲開發已經成為國內最大的Serverless開發平臺。
“小程式·雲開發”是騰訊雲與微信聯合推出的微信官方雲原生開發平臺,平臺採用Serverless架構,整合騰訊云云函式、容器、雲端儲存、雲資料庫等後端能力,讓開發者無需自行搭建、運維伺服器,即可在平臺上開發、上線應用。除了小程式,雲開發還支援公眾號、Web應用、H5等,未來還將向App等更多端拓展,開發者可以一次開發、多端部署,顯著提升開發效率、降低成本。
騰訊雲副總裁劉穎指出,過去一年多的實踐資料顯示,藉助雲開發,應用開發的人力成本可以降低50%、雲資源使用成本可降低30%,“雲開發集成了微信生態和騰訊雲的各項能力,是騰訊C2B戰略的技術抓手。”
從去年的“不止於快”,到今年的“重新定義開發”,騰訊在雲開發上佈局速度不斷加快,路徑也更加明確。透過豐富自身產品能力和應用場景,雲開發進一步擴大開發者生態:一方面,雲開發簡化後端服務呼叫,新增了雲託管服務,支援多語言、多框架,讓開發者成為“全棧開發者”;另一方面,雲開發新推出低程式碼開發平臺,讓產品、運營等快速搭建應用,越來越多的角色藉助雲開發成為“開發者”。
從單點雲開發到全面雲開發
過去一年間,雲開發持續整合微信開發生態介面,產品能力不斷豐富。微信小程式及雲開發創始團隊核心負責人林超表示,微信生態正在從單點雲開發進入到全面雲開發。
在場景方面,透過環境共享、靜態託管等,實現從小程式向公眾號網頁,即Web端開發的場景拓展,進一步滿足開發者的多端業務訴求。
在能力方面,雲呼叫不僅支援小程式服務端API免鑑權呼叫,也支援公眾號服務端、微信支付能力、微信廣告能力的免鑑權呼叫,讓開發者更簡單便捷地呼叫整個微信生態開放能力。
在服務模式上,除了提供函式級別的Serverless化部署方式以外,雲開發也提供了相容Knative生態標準的Serverless容器服務模式,即雲託管。在雲託管模式下,無論是前端開發者、還是後臺開發者,都可以使用雲開發部署小程式和網頁,不受語言和框架限制。
同時,雲開發已全面支援服務商的小程式SaaS部署模式,提供批次操作介面,實現雲資源的統一管理和財務結算,進而提升服務商的小程式SaaS交付效率,降低後期運維成本。
低碼平臺,人人都可以是“開發者”
在當天的峰會上,騰訊雲正式推出雲開發低程式碼平臺,進一步降低應用開發的門檻。低程式碼開發平臺是指無需編碼或透過少量程式碼就可以快速生成應用程式的開發平臺,使用者可以透過拖拽相應的功能模組,建立應用。
騰訊雲副總裁劉穎指出,透過低程式碼開發平臺,沒有技術背景的產品、運營也可以用雲開發做應用。在開發門檻極大降低之後,人人都是可以是“開發者”。對工程師而言,低碼平臺是一個提升生產效率的工具,避免進行重複性工作,可以更加專注於業務邏輯創新、專注架構和演算法設計。
以粵省事小程式為例,業務人員要在小程式中開發一個新的“貧困認證”功能。使用低程式碼平臺開發,直接複用了政務基礎元件和已有業務邏輯抽象,程式碼行數從2000多行降低到61行,檔案個數從42個縮減為1個,整體的交付效率提升了至少5倍。
聯合行業啟動制定首個雲開發標準
會上,中國電子技術標準化研究院聯合騰訊雲及眾多行業頭部企業,宣佈共同啟動《資訊科技 雲計算 雲開發通用技術要求》標準編制工作。該標準由騰訊雲牽頭,為雲計算領域首個雲開發標準化方向的標準。
雲開發標準編制,召集了產業眾多開發者、服務商、雲廠商等,推動行業在產品規範、互聯互通等層面達成共識,藉助雲計算標準推動雲開發在更多場景、更多行業落地,為使用者提供標準化的雲原生一體化開發環境和工具。
(圖片由騰訊授權使用)